Worcester Ruby Legs

The plaque above located on the Becker college campus in Worcester Massachusetts was as you can see, the place where Lee Richmond threw for the 1st perfect game in Major League Baseball history.  The team Lee Richmond played for was of course the Worcester Ruby Legs who in 1883 became the Philadelphia Quakers who in turn later became the Philadelphia Phillies
